How to Make Slime - Our Favorite Slime Recipes


Our Favorite Slime Recipes - FbSlime popularity is soaring! 

Making homemade slime is an easy and fun activity for kids. Besides being just fun, it is physically,  mentally, and educationally beneficial.  Slime can help relieve stress and anxiety, can help with eye and hand coordination, can build hand muscles, can build fine motor skills and can teach kids a science lesson.  It can be helpful for kids with ADHD or SPD.
